WorkWhen a force applied to an object, moves that object.

PowerThe rate at which work is done; the amount of work done per time it takes to do it.

ForceSomething that causes a change in the motion of an object, measured in Newtons.

Applied ForceThe force with which an object has been pushed or pulled by another object.

Balanced ForceWhen two forces acting on an object are equal in size but act in opposite directions.

Unbalanced ForceForces that cause a change in the motion of an object because one force is of lesser magnitude than the other.

EnergyAnything that can change the condition of matter. Commonly defined as the ability to do work.

Kinetic EnergyEnergy of motion.

Potential EnergyThe stored energy that an object possesses because of its position with respect to other objects.

MotionChange in the position of an object.

MassThe amount of matter in an object.

SpeedThe time rate at which distance is covered by a moving object.

ProportionalHaving a constant ratio to another quantity.

LinearA relationship in which increasing or decreasing one variable will cause a corresponding increase or decrease in the other variable too.

RatioA comparison between two numbers, showing the relationship between the two.
